2010年10月27日
摘要: 1、命令行rm -rf /System/Library/Extensions.kextcacherm -rf /System/Library/Extensions.mkextchown -R root:wheel /System/Library/Extensionschmod -R 755 /System/Library/Extensions前面两句是清空缓存的,如果执行后提示找不到文件,不用理会... 阅读全文
posted @ 2010-10-27 14:28 raychn 阅读(4279) 评论(0) 推荐(0) 编辑
摘要: 1) 禁行标志出现禁行标志是因为AHCI功能未开启,只需在BIOS里更改设置即可。若主板或硬盘不支持AHCI或有特殊原因不能开启AHCI,则需要在bootthink下添加kext。kext安装在C:\Darwin\System\LibrarySL\Extensions\即可。若不是SATA硬盘,则需要另外搜索主板ATA芯片的kext文件来驱动。2) “五国”加载安装文件时出... 阅读全文
posted @ 2010-10-27 09:23 raychn 阅读(3800) 评论(0) 推荐(0) 编辑
  2010年10月11日
摘要: 小红伞杀毒软件,09年出中文版,免费版的性能实在太好了,内存低,杀毒能力超强,一直很喜欢,建议大家不要用360杀毒,免费不错,不过杀毒能力实在不会让你放心,可以选择 小红伞,xp ,2000 sp4系统直接安装,官方中文版:http://www.free-av.com/zh-cn/download/index.html但是 2000 2003服务器版系统就不能么顺利,以下是安装步骤,可以在服务器上... 阅读全文
posted @ 2010-10-11 20:08 raychn 阅读(4587) 评论(1) 推荐(0) 编辑
  2010年8月4日
摘要: 最近我公司新配置了一台T610,其中安装的是最新的Server系统:Win2008R2。可是当我把UPS接上RS232后,却一直无法在系统中找到UPS管理配置界面。以前的Win2003,可以在控制面板的电源选项中配置UPS的。经过上Microsoft的Forum,才知道,从Vista开始到2008R2,Windows已经不再支持串口的UPS设备了。只有具备USB管理接口的UPS,才能被系统识别并在... 阅读全文
posted @ 2010-08-04 09:22 raychn 阅读(2605) 评论(1) 推荐(0) 编辑
  2010年7月28日
摘要: 在写CS框架第2版时遇到换肤问题,最初设计思路是建立一个窗体frmBase,继承XtraForm,在窗体拖放一个DefaultLookAndFeel控件,项目内所有窗体都继承frmBase类。在frmBase_Load事件内设 this.DefaultLookAndFeel.LookAndFeel.SkinName = skinName就可以设置皮肤。然而,这种设计带来一个问题: 当打开一个窗体时加载两次皮肤引起NavBarControl控件闪烁! 阅读全文
posted @ 2010-07-28 14:07 raychn 阅读(2502) 评论(2) 推荐(1) 编辑
摘要: 第一步:让所有窗体都从DevExpress.XtraEditors.XtraForm继承。 第二步:添加两个引用: DevExpress.BonusSkins.v8.1DevExpress.OfficeSkins.v8.1 阅读全文
posted @ 2010-07-28 14:01 raychn 阅读(1784) 评论(0) 推荐(0) 编辑
摘要: 学习要点 1.C#操作Access数据库,实现增/删/改/查功能 2.实现从Excel导入数据到Access数据库 3.简单的MDI框架实现(学习重点!!!) 4.业务逻辑分层(界面展示层,业务逻辑层,数据访问层) 5.接口应用,创建观察者模式 6.C/S结构的系统框架设计 阅读全文
posted @ 2010-07-28 13:51 raychn 阅读(1756) 评论(2) 推荐(1) 编辑
摘要: 如对线程的操作不正确,在跨线程调用Windows窗体控件时会有产生InvalidOperationException异常。 该异常提示[线程间操作无效: 从不是创建控件“listBox1”的线程访问它.]。 我相信很多人通过设置Control.CheckForIllegalCrossThreadCalls属性为false禁止捕获对错误线程的调用。 这种强制性的禁止捕获不是人性化的选项。 我们可以通过控件的Invoke方法来实现跨线程调用Windows窗体控件。 阅读全文
posted @ 2010-07-28 13:35 raychn 阅读(1291) 评论(0) 推荐(0) 编辑
摘要: 委托 (Delegate) 委托是一种定义方法签名的类型,可以与具有兼容签名的任何方法关联。您可以通过委托调用方法。委托用于将方法作为参数传递给其他方法。事件处理程序就是通过委托调用的方法。 与委托的签名匹配的任何可访问类或结构中的任何方法都可以分配给该委托。方法可以是静态方法,也可以是实例方法。这样就可以通过编程方式来更改方法调用,还可以向现有类中插入新代码。只要知道委托的签名,就可以分配您自己的方法。 阅读全文
posted @ 2010-07-28 13:27 raychn 阅读(822) 评论(0) 推荐(0) 编辑
摘要: 观察者模式应用非常之广,是我最喜爱的设计模式之一。 常用的数据库管理系统中有这种情况: 客户要求数据字典改变后要实时更新相关业务窗体的数据。 如下图[销售单]和[采购单]业务窗体中分别有货币和单位数据字典选择框。货币和单位数据是在打开窗体 时加载的,假设客户需要增加一个货币或单位,在不关闭[销售单]和[采购单]窗体的前提下,如何使货币和单位数据保持最新? 阅读全文
posted @ 2010-07-28 11:59 raychn 阅读(554) 评论(0) 推荐(0) 编辑